The r_config_set function in libr/config/config.c in radare2 1.5.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(use-after-free and application crash) via a crafted DEX file.

CVE-2017-9520 is a high-severity vulnerability that can lead to denial of service through a use-after-free condition.
To fix CVE-2017-9520, update radare2 to a version beyond 1.5.0 that includes the patch addressing this vulnerability.
CVE-2017-9520 allows remote attackers to exploit the vulnerability through crafted DEX files, causing crashes.
CVE-2017-9520 exists in radare2 version 1.5.0.
While CVE-2017-9520 primarily results in application crashes, it may lead to potential data loss depending on the state of the application at the time of the crash.
